“An utter lack of grid discipline” and “a sheer lack of effective regulation” set the scene for the power crisis, said the Economic Times. “But mostly, the grid failure underscores the fact that politically powerful states can overdraw power from the grid with impunity.”

In India’s states, electricity is heavily subsidized, and distribution companies are mired in debt. Generation capacity has risen significantly in the past few years as private producers have set up power stations, but distribution companies are often too indebted to pay.

To make matters worse, up to 40 percent of the power that is generated is either stolen or leaks away from poorly insulated lines, thanks to decade of under-investment in the grid.

Certainly you are correct about primary distribution that leaking insulation would cause arcing in HV conductors but you forget that a large part of the distribution grid is secondary at 400 to 440 volts. I can attest there is a lot of insulation leakage there. Mostly the heating of the soil is load, not arcing faults. You really want to be careful where you walk in Delhi on a rainy day as i am told that the ground can tingle. From what I saw October of 2010 a lot of open (taped) splices on the ground. Regularly saw feeder and service conductors on the road for a foot or 2 before entering street distribution kiosks. Not uncommon to see the kiosks have been broken into and fuses and other metal bits have been stolen. Yes they are hemorrhaging electricity.

If you care -- the juice sent to India's farmers is generally NEVER metered.

Instead, that expense is picked up by the national government via subsidies to the power system operators -- which are, generally, government owned bodies at the 'state level.'

( These Indian states are as populous as major nations. )

Not withstanding lousy distribution practices -- it's the MASSIVE shunting of power to non-payers like farmers that explains the astounding 'lost' billings.

The fraction of energy lost in ground resistance is a total joke compared to the numbers discussed above.

Another massive problem -- across the 3rd world -- is out right meter by-passing theft. This is done with a wink, a nod and a corrupt pay-off by crony capitalists.

The nation as a whole is expected to pick up their tab. Once this gets rolling -- each and every businessman wants in -- lest he be left as the last idiot actually paying his power bill.

Having been through India, I'd hazard a guess and say that the problem isn't really the poor distribution system, but the fact that so many of the users on that system are making illegal, un-metered connections to this system.

While I was over there, the figure of 29% of the total capacity of these grids are supplying "installations" that are not supposed to be connected to it.
Add to the fact that these connections are more than likely not fused at all, so any short circuit that happens has some pretty hideous results, namely fires and grid failures.

What should be happening here, is the authorities in charge of these grids, should be going around and lopping off any un-authorised connections, as this sort of thing is tantamount to theft.
